Becoming a pigment that filters yellow light at the center of the macula
If my eyes feel dim or I look at a screen for a long time, will taking zeaxanthin improve my vision or prevent macular degeneration? In short, while zeaxanthin is a yellow-spectrum carotenoid that accumulates in the retinal macula, there is insufficient evidence to conclude that it is a supplement that relieves fatigue in healthy eyes or restores vision. The most well-known clinical evidence, the AREDS2 study, was a study on a complex formula targeting specific macular degeneration patients, not an experiment to prevent eye issues for everyone using zeaxanthin alone.
While yellow pigments from plants become pigments that filter light at the center of the macula and are then compressed into a single 'eye supplement' pill, the paths for relieving fatigue in normal eyes, changes in macular pigment density, and inhibiting the progression of diagnosed macular degeneration diverge. It is essential to distinguish this gap.

Identity of the ingredient: Pigment at the center of the macula
Zeaxanthin is a yellow pigment concentrated in the retinal macula, particularly in the center. This pigment, along with lutein and meso-zeaxanthin, constitutes the macular pigment. While there are studies showing that carotenoids increase macular pigment density or change glare indices, restoring vision lost due to glasses prescription, cataracts, or retinal diseases is a different outcome.
Then, what should we look at? We must first acknowledge the gap between what research measures and what we feel. An increase in pigment does not necessarily mean improved vision.
Why expectations are high: The name AREDS2
The strongest clinical evidence for zeaxanthin is the AREDS2 study. This was a complex formula study that followed approximately 4,200 high-risk participants for macular degeneration for an average of about 5 years. The important point is that this was not a study testing the preventive effect of zeaxanthin alone in healthy eyes.
The AREDS2 formula includes Vitamin C, E, zinc, and copper in addition to lutein and zeaxanthin. Therefore, the results of this formula cannot be broken down into the effect of zeaxanthin alone. Just because it is called AREDS2 does not mean everyone experiences the same effect.
Difference between two contexts: Beta-carotene replacement vs. general prevention
The context of replacing beta-carotene in the original AREDS formula with lutein and zeaxanthin is different from the context of a healthy person taking single zeaxanthin for preventive purposes. In the primary analysis of AREDS2, the overall effect of adding lutein and zeaxanthin to the existing AREDS formula did not meet the primary endpoint. However, signals of benefit appeared in the beta-carotene replacement comparison and in subgroup analysis of those with low dietary intake.
The National Eye Institute of the US states that AREDS2 supplements are used to lower the risk of progression in patients with intermediate macular degeneration or late macular degeneration in one eye. This means it is not a general preventive agent for people with early macular degeneration or those without the disease.
Foods and supplements: Same ingredients, different questions
Zeaxanthin is found in corn, egg yolks, and orange bell peppers. Dietary intake and concentrated supplements deal with the same ingredients but address different questions. Food can be seen as part of a balanced diet, while supplements are a form of taking concentrated specific ingredients quantitatively.
The criteria for choosing between obtaining zeaxanthin from food versus choosing a single-ingredient or complex capsule product are different. In particular, since products that look similar to AREDS2 may have different amounts of zinc, copper, and beta-carotene, you must check the entire label.
When taking with medications or supplements
When considering zeaxanthin alongside other supplements or medications, check three things first: whether it is single zeaxanthin, a product containing lutein and meso-zeaxanthin, or an AREDS2 complex product. You should also check the content of lutein, zeaxanthin, zinc, copper, and beta-carotene in the product, as well as your smoking history.
Current or former smokers should avoid older AREDS-type products that contain beta-carotene. However, this does not mean zeaxanthin itself is risky. It means you must examine whether the total ingredients of a complex product are appropriate for your individual situation.
Individual circumstances and safety signals
Data regarding high-dose, long-term use of single zeaxanthin, as well as use during pregnancy, breastfeeding, and in children, are limited. Therefore, more caution is required in these situations.
More urgent are abnormal signals appearing in your vision. If the center of your vision is suddenly blocked, straight lines appear curved, you see flashes of light, or you experience vision loss like a curtain, do not wait for supplements and seek an immediate ophthalmology visit or emergency evaluation. These symptoms may indicate a condition that cannot be resolved with supplements.
The Gap Between Human Evidence and Expectations
Expectations for zeaxanthin often arise from mixing three different stages: first, the biological fact of its presence in the macula; second, observations of increased macular pigment density; and third, the recovery of vision or preventive effects for everyone. The first two stages do not naturally lead to the third.
In other words, AREDS2 is a study that showed the potential for a complex formula to inhibit progression in a specific patient group. Expanding this to the relief of daily eye fatigue or vision recovery in healthy individuals goes beyond the boundaries of the evidence.
Differences from similar raw materials
Zeaxanthin, along with lutein and meso-zeaxanthin, makes up the macular pigment. These have different locations and distributions within the macula, and depending on the product, they may come as a single ingredient, a combination of two, or a form containing all three. Furthermore, a zeaxanthin-only product and the AREDS2 complex formula are not the same thing.
It is necessary to distinguish between eye fatigue/vision decline and the risk of progression of age-related macular degeneration. The former is a symptom that can have various causes, while the latter is the progression of a disease that requires a diagnosis.
